Rapid Reaction: Water Harm Recovery Tips When faced with water damage, acting fast is vital to minimize the damage. Initially, secure everyone involved and shut off the supply if you can safely do it. Then, begin eliminating standing water with pails and rags. Don't fail to to document the extent of the damage for claims. Finally, ventilation is critical to avoid mold growth – open windows and use fans to speed up the process as quickly as possible. Preventing Water Damage: A Proactive Approach Protecting the property from water destruction requires a careful and forward-thinking strategy. Ignoring potential risks can lead to expensive restorations and troublesome situations. Implementing a few easy measures can significantly minimize the possibility of water entry. These steps include: Regularly examine water lines for drips. Ensure drains are clean and functioning properly. Verify that appliances such as dishwashers are connected correctly and cared for regularly. Consider fitting water sensors to provide early notices of approaching complications. Keep essential documents and items stored in protected containers. By taking a proactive stance, you can safeguard one's investment and avoid the devastation of water destruction. Water Damage Cleanup Costs & What to Expect Dealing with the water leak can be overwhelming, and knowing the associated repair expenses is important. Initial response efforts—like protecting valuables and stopping further moisture entry—might just incur minor charges. However, check here professional water damage cleanup services generally involve various stages. These may encompass inspection, water removal, drying out the space, fungus control, and repairing compromised materials. Costs vary greatly depending on incident's extent. Limited leaks may total between $500 and $3,000, though extensive overflows can readily reach $10,000 or greater. Considerations impacting the bill include area size, the moisture flooding, types of items involved, region, and the action.
